Printed black and white in black and brown printed wraps. A series of photographs of ploughed earth by Audrey Walker, printed black and white, overlaid with translucent pages printed with Finlay's minimal concrete poetry. An ambitious publication where Finlay asked Salamander Press to print on Wild Hawthorn Presses belhalf. The juxtaposition of text and images seem like a prequal to later British land art publications. The final page involves a single full stop to the centre, that according to Finlay 'indicated a calculated space or pause, gives a winter earth or dark and narrowed O.', Finlay also writes that the poem 'arose from digging in the earth. there is also the idea of digging the earth, while the earh, the world, turns over, away from the sun, into winter' (ref. 'Midway: Letters from Ian Hamilton Finlay to Stephen Bann 1964-69', Wilmington Square Books, London UK, 2014). Ref Murray 3.16. Unsigned, no edition size given.
